OK, The Paper Players have a musical theme challenge going on this week so I just had to play along. I love music in any form and always have it playing while stamping. It also gave me a good excuse to use my “Music Notes” wheel. It’s a goody for music lovers.
I choose the Timeless Portrait Designer Series paper as the background. It goes well with the Christmas greeting I was thinking of.
The music notes could be any Christmas song that you wish to imagine! I inked up the wheel with Basic Black Craft ink, the Black Stampin’ Emboss powder and heat set it all.
The beautifully written greeting was inked up with Versamark and heat set with Cherry Cobbler Stampin’ Emboss powder. I cut it out free-hand with paper snips and attached it using Stampin’ Dimensionals.
I used the 3/4″ Circle punch for the faces from Timeless Portrait DSP and matted them onto 1″ Circles of Cherry Cobbler.
RECIPE:
Stamp Set: Hand-Penned Holidays(124312)
Card Stock: Basic Black, Cherry Cobbler, Very Vanilla, Timeless Portrait Designer Series Paper(122352)
Ink: Basic Black Craft(102192)
Accessories: Music Notes Standard Wheel(120327), Standard Handle(102971), Versamark(102283), Stampin’ Emboss Powder-Black(109133)-Cherry Cobbler(122949), Heat Tool(100005), 3/4″ Circle Punch(119873), 1″ Circle Punch(119868), 3/8″ Cherry Cobbler Quilted Satin Ribbon(124105), Stampin’ Dimensionals(104430), Snail Adhesive(104332), Paper Snips(103579), Paper Cutter(104152), Simply Scored(122334)
